Question Cuttoff Date & Time 11/10/2022 05:00:00 PM (ET) The City is seeking a qualified marine Contractor to furnish all labor, equipment, tools, and materials to replace a section of concrete bulkhead and marginal dock at the Alsdorf Park public boat ramp facility located at 2901 NE 14 th St., Pompano Beach, FL, 33062, on the north side of the 14 th Street Causeway along the westerly shoreline of the Intracoastal Waterway (ICWW). The section of bulkhead and dock to be replaced extends from the easterly boat ramp along the Caliban Canal to the confluence of the ICWW. The existing bulkhead is approximately 370 feet in length and comprised of concrete panels, concrete Tpiles and concrete cap supported laterally by combination of concrete batter piles and tie-back systems. The marginal dock is five (5) feet wide, approximately 350 feet in length and constructed using pressure treated timber piles and substructure with composite decking. The proposed project includes the demolition and removal of the existing bulkhead and dock and reconstruction of the bulkhead using concrete panels, concrete king and batter piles and concrete cap. As an alternate, the City is seeking a price to reconstruct the bulkhead using composite sheet pile with concrete cap and concrete batter piles. As a requirement, the bidder must provide pricing for both the concrete bulkhead and the sheet pile alternative. The City will determine which alternative method will be used. It is a requirement that the new bulkhead be constructed no further waterward than the existing wall, which will necessitate the removal of the existing bulkhead in its entirety. A small section of the new bulkhead, approximately 53 feet in length, will be offset landward of the existing bulkhead six (6) feet to allow for the installation of a 40-foot floating platform. Bulkhead construction activities will require the removal and restoration of asphalt and addition of gravel stormwater collection areas with small catch basins and jet filter discharges. Fill will be required over a section of the new bulkhead to elevate natural grades to the level of the new concrete cap.
